What is an ethical investment ISA?
An ethical investment ISA is a type of Individual Savings Account (ISA) that allows individuals to invest in companies and projects that are considered socially and environmentally responsible These investments typically avoid industries such as fossil fuels, weapons, tobacco, and gambling, and instead focus on sectors like renewable energy, healthcare, and education.
By investing in an ethical ISA, individuals can support companies that make a positive impact on society while also potentially earning financial returns This allows investors to align their money with their morals and contribute to a more sustainable economy.

How to choose an ethical ISA provider?

The first step is to research the provider’s investment philosophy and screening criteria Some providers may have stricter ethical standards than others, so it’s important to choose one that aligns with your values.
It’s also important to consider the performance track record of the provider’s ethical ISA products While past performance is not indicative of future results, it can provide valuable insights into how the provider’s investments have fared in different market conditions.
Additionally, investors should consider the fees associated with the ethical ISA Some providers may charge higher fees for their ethical products, so it’s essential to understand the cost implications of investing with a particular provider.
Finally, investors should look for providers that offer comprehensive reporting and transparency It’s important to have access to information about where your money is being invested and the impact it’s making, so look for providers that are committed to providing regular updates and disclosures.
